A host of world-class footballers have whopping €1billion release clauses in their contracts, including Real Madrid and England star Jude Bellingham

Jude Bellingham has a staggering €1billion release clause in his Real Madrid contract – but he’s far from the only player with such a massive bounty on his head.

Mammoth release clauses are commonplace for the best players on the planet, but they are particularly prevalent in Spain, where they are actually mandatory. Naturally, the best players accrue the highest figures.

Bellingham joined Real from Dortmund in the summer for an initial fee of £88million, rising to £114million with add-ons. Given his blistering form, with some hailing him as the finest player in the world at present, it is proving to be money very well spen

His release fee is even more eye-watering at more than €1billion. That’s a jaw-dropping £871million. Other high-profile players in Spain have similar fees on their heads, including numerous Barcelona stars.

They include striker Ferran Torres, who signed for Barca after little more than a year at Manchester City, where he struggled to make an impact under Pep Guardiola. The Camp Nou giants coughed up €55million, plus add-ons, for the Spain international.

Talented team-mates Pedri, Gavi, Ronald Araujo are also believed to have €1billion release clauses. Another player with that stonking price on his head is currently at Brighton, Ansu Fati, who is on loan from Barca after rejecting a switch to Tottenham.

Meanwhile, Bellingham is not the only Real Madrid player with such a hefty release fee, with Vinicius Junior and Eduardo Camavinga also reportedly having €1billion clauses inserted in their contracts.

Some of the Premier League’s top players also have sizeable release clauses, although they aren’t in the same ballpark as the aforementioned players. Kevin De Bruyne is believed to have a £213million release fee in his Man City contract. Meanwhile, Etihad team-mate Erling Haaland’s figure is a little lower at €200million (£175million).
